New Delhi: Amid a slew of #metoo allegations surfacing on social media, a filmmaker has levelled sexual harassment allegations against author Suhel Seth.

In a series of screenshots of Whatsapp messages sent directly to Seth, the woman has 'thanked' him for 'not raping' her saying, "Over time, I've learnt to manage you. But no woman should ever have to 'manage' the misuse of power and 'manage' being sexually assaulted."

Seth, the managing partner of a consultancy firm and a well-known fixture in the city's party circuits, has not released any official comment nor tweeted a  response yet. 

Filmmaker Pritish Nandy, who a few days ago claimed Seth to be his 'nephew' on social media, has tweeted a diplomatic response in his favour saying, 'It is his business. He will answer.'
